Transaction fdbbea597138dba9d889b7234c6c99873d7d25ff43441c41543669f795773320

2 Input
2 Outputs
  • fdbbea597138dba9d889b7234c6c99873d7d25ff43441c41543669f795773320:0
  • value  20787126
    address  3KMLePovhzqcW2sk5AFHCq4TZuQAJEWChY
  • fdbbea597138dba9d889b7234c6c99873d7d25ff43441c41543669f795773320:1
  • value  36950119
    address  3FPePaxcbbCpAKVFXzHsJvhevhQ1hzynMy